The China-ASEAN Free Trade Area (CAFTA) has been fully operational for more than three years, with the bulk of tariff reductions already phased in. The exclusion of Hong Kong from CAFTA has aroused considerable concern over the likelihood of trade diversion from Hong Kong as a key re-export hub involved in China-ASEAN trade. That impact, however, has not proved to be as severe as first thought and a simple solution may now be at hand. More
